If the description wouldn't have detailed the premise of this film...I would have had no idea what was going on.

Sure, it's pretty obvious that she miraculously regained her hearing, as a result of an experimental medical procedure, after losing it to meningitis as a child.

But as for the rest of the plot...it's not exactly evident.

Less that there is a serial killer operating in the area.

And the he has her in his sights.

The whole supernatural element- and her supposed psychic abilities- manifest in both bizarre and confusing ways.

To the point where I'm not exactly sure how they helped drive the storyline forward.

The whole thing is rather slow burning...and plods on for much longer than it needs to.

Meaning that it's a bit too bloated for what it is.

That being said, the acting- particularly from the lead actress- is decent enough to keep you engaged.

Even though the whole thing is rather boring.

Up until it's somewhat disturbingly violent final act.

However, that's not exactly enough to safe it from it's inherent mediocrity.

No doubt, the concept is kind of intriguing.

However, the film itself is really quite passable.

And probably would have been more interesting if she was just deaf the whole time.

Especially considering the ending is kind of ridiculous.

Either way...it definitely did not need to be over 2 hours long.
